This announcement pleases me greatly. I love the Handa-kun manga as much as I do Barakamon. Handa-kun (manga) has a slightly different feel to it than Barakamon does due to the difference in Handa's age and the different settings. So don't go into Handa-kun (anime) expecting a rehash of Barakamon. However, if you didn't like Barakamon at all, I'm not sure that Handa-kun will be different enough to pull you in.
